This is a new upstream version of efibootmgr, which has implications
well beyond the new version of fwupdate that this is intended to
facilitate.

Why is the breaks against 0.12-2?  (vs. 0.12-1)  If there is a specific
distro patch in 0.12-2, then I believe we should cherry-pick that patch
into vivid efibootmgr if possible, and adjust the breaks on the version
of efibootmgr in vivid.  If that isn't possible (because the patch
doesn't cherry-pick cleanly) we will need more detailed analysis of the
upstream changes between 0.11.0 and 0.12 to confirm that these are
sufficently low-risk.
